Martin Kutschker wrote:
> I'm a strong believer in rights-belong-to-groups setups. So the fact 
> that you can set things up in user accounts is sometmes nice, but mostly 
> a threat to a good rights management.
> 
> So I'd like to see a "show access lists" settings for users as well. 
> Unless this is check nearly all options would be hidden.

There are two ways to do it: use type field or use conditions. As there were no type field for this table, some exts could create one. If another type field is added, it may break exts. So if access lists are implemented, it is better to use conditions+reload-in-ctrl to hide/show other fields.
